This special re-print edition of Clater's "Every Man His Own Cattle Doctor" is considered one of the most important works ever published on Cattle diseases. First published in 1832, this important work on the care of cattle and other livestock, has not seen the light of day since its early publication. Included in this work are four sections, The Diseases of Cattle, The Diseases of Sheep, The Diseases of Poultry and the Diseases of Rabbits. Offers unique insight into how early cattle and horse breeders dealt with, treated and cured common ailments of livestock.
